    Your Guide to Search Engine Visibility

    Search Engine Optimization (SEO) determines whether potential customers find you or your competitors. For many businesses, organic search traffic represents the largest source of qualified leads. Understanding SEO fundamentals is essential for anyone with a website.

    How Search Engines Work

    Crawling and Indexing

    Search engines discover content through:

    • Following links across the web
    • Processing submitted sitemaps
    • Rendering JavaScript content
    • Storing page information in indexes

    Ranking Factors

    Google uses hundreds of factors, but key ones include:

    • Content relevance to search queries
    • Page quality and depth
    • Backlink quantity and quality
    • User experience signals
    • Technical health

    On-Page SEO Fundamentals

    Title Tags

    The most important on-page element:

    • Include primary keyword
    • Keep under 60 characters
    • Make compelling for clicks
    • Unique per page

    Meta Descriptions

    Not a ranking factor, but crucial for CTR:

    • Summarize page content
    • Include call to action
    • 150-160 characters
    • Use primary and secondary keywords naturally

    Header Structure

    Organize content logically:

    • One H1 per page (your main topic)
    • H2s for major sections
    • H3-H6 for subsections
    • Include keywords naturally

    Content Quality

    Google rewards helpful content:

    • Answer search intent comprehensively
    • Original insights and information
    • Well-researched and accurate
    • Regular updates for freshness

    Technical SEO Basics

    Site Speed

    Fast sites rank better:

    • Core Web Vitals (LCP, INP, CLS)
    • Image optimization
    • Browser caching
    • Minimal render-blocking resources

    Mobile Friendliness

    Google uses mobile-first indexing:

    • Responsive design
    • Touch-friendly elements
    • Readable without zooming
    • Same content as desktop

    Crawlability

    Help search engines find content:

    • Logical site structure
    • XML sitemap
    • Robots.txt configuration
    • Internal linking

    Security

    HTTPS is expected:

    • SSL certificate
    • Secure forms
    • No mixed content warnings

    Keyword Research

    Understanding Intent

    Match content to what users want:

    • Informational: "how to" queries
    • Navigational: brand searches
    • Commercial: "best" and comparison queries
    • Transactional: "buy" queries

    Finding Keywords

    Research tools and methods:

    • Google's autocomplete suggestions
    • Related searches at page bottom
    • Google Keyword Planner
    • SEO tools (Ahrefs, SEMrush)
    • Customer questions and feedback

    Keyword Selection

    Balance relevance and opportunity:

    • Search volume (how many searches)
    • Competition level (how hard to rank)
    • Relevance to your business
    • Current ranking position

    Link Building Fundamentals

    Why Links Matter

    Backlinks are votes of confidence:

    • Quality over quantity
    • Relevance of linking site
    • Anchor text signals
    • Link placement context

    Ethical Link Earning

    Build links through value:

    • Create link-worthy content
    • Guest posting on relevant sites
    • Industry relationships
    • Digital PR efforts
    • Resource page outreach

    Internal Linking

    Connect your own pages:

    • Help crawlers find content
    • Distribute page authority
    • Guide user journeys
    • Use descriptive anchor text

    Local SEO

    For Local Businesses

    Appear in local searches:

    • Google Business Profile optimization
    • Consistent NAP (Name, Address, Phone)
    • Local citations and directories
    • Reviews and ratings
    • Local content creation

    Measuring SEO Success

    Key Metrics

    • Organic traffic (Google Analytics)
    • Keyword rankings (SEO tools)
    • Click-through rates (Search Console)
    • Backlink growth (SEO tools)
    • Conversions from organic traffic

    Google Search Console

    Essential free tool:

    • See what queries bring traffic
    • Identify indexing issues
    • Monitor Core Web Vitals
    • Submit sitemaps

    Common SEO Mistakes

    Keyword Stuffing

    Using keywords unnaturally hurts more than helps.

    Ignoring Mobile

    Most searches happen on mobile devices.

    Thin Content

    Pages with little value don't rank.

    Buying Links

    Paid links violate guidelines and risk penalties.

    Duplicate Content

    Multiple pages for same content dilute rankings.

    Getting Started

    Begin with these steps:

    1. Claim and optimize Google Business Profile (if local)
    2. Ensure site is mobile-friendly
    3. Fix any indexing issues in Search Console
    4. Research primary keywords for main pages
    5. Optimize title tags and meta descriptions
    6. Create helpful content regularly
    7. Build internal links between related content

    SEO is a long-term investment. Results take months, but the traffic compounds over time. Start with fundamentals, stay consistent, and avoid shortcuts that risk penalties.
